Dena Boronkay Rashes: Circle of Excellence Leadership Award

Dena is a passionate volunteer whose extraordinary generosity and steadfast commitment to the local and global Jewish community inspire all who work with her. She approaches every project with seasoned perspective, creativity, and a willingness to think big and innovate, all in service of ensuring CJP continues to grow from strength to strength, especially during times of transition for the organization. Over the years, Dena has held —and redefined — many leadership roles within CJP, including Chair of our Committee on Development, Co-chair of our Annual Campaign, and member of our Board of Directors. Now, as Co-chair of our Cynthia & Leon Shulman Acharai Leadership Program, she’s drawing on her extensive experience to help shape and inspire CJP’s next generation of leaders. Beyond Boston, Dena represents our community on the national stage through her deep involvement with The Jewish Federations of North America and JDC. As a leader, Dena truly brings joy and a hopeful spirit to the work. Even in challenging moments — like during her time on CJP’s Israel Emergency Task Force after the October 7 attacks — she always reminds us of the power of Jewish community and all we can achieve together.
